BBSNews Editorial 2008-03-11 -- Does Senator John McCain, the presumptive GOP nominee, agree with Republicans who yesterday applauded Oklahoma State Representative Sally Kern's offensive speech against gays and Islam? No word yet, but when McCain yesterday declared himself "cancer free" he probably did not know that another Republican lawmaker from the heartland had a "cancer" of another kind on her mind and spilling from her lips when she compared gays to a cancer [of the toe no less]. Republicans have long been lumped with anti-gay bias, even though it seems a lot of them get accidentally get caught up in the "gay agenda" in airport bathrooms or outside Congressional page dorm rooms. And it's been reported that they have an unusual liking for episodes of Will & Grace. According to the Oklahoman she has verified the remarks posted by the Gay and Lesbian Victory Fund in a video release and she does not plan to apologize saying, "I said nothing that was not true, I said nothing out of hate and I don't believe my colleagues will censure me." Given the GOP's history of extreme anti-gay rhetoric and outright war against equal rights and treatment under the law for America's Gay, Lesbian, Bisexual and Transgender population she is, sadly, probably right. Many Republicans simply don't consider speeches like this "hate". And it's a sure bet that they won't likely touch her remarks about Islam. Simply reading the near-violent undercurrent in anonymous comments on right-wing news sites shows that there is a seething visceral hatred being fomented in America against Gays, Muslims and of course Hispanic immigrants. It is an underbelly of fear and loathing and ignorance that must be rubbed by today's GOP candidates just to get elected, so they must throw out carefully couched anti-gay, anti-immigrant, and anti-Muslim "red meat" to satisfy it, and that is in itself a "death knell" - not for America - but for the Republican Party as it is currently presenting itself at every opportunity. GOP Standing Ovation In Tulsa world it was reported that during a closed (Is it any wonder?) Republican caucus meeting yesterday she related some of the "5,000" emails, apparently some with language she had "never heard before", to the attendees of the meeting, her Republican colleagues, and they gave her a standing ovation. Is it any wonder that so many Americans are finding that the Republican Party has become dinosaur-like and completely out of touch with the values of real people as opposed to those, like Sally Kern, who would force their narrow and twisted view of Christianity on the rest of the country? She looks so sweet, like she could be serving a nice, fresh, hot out of the oven, batch of cookies and glasses of cold milk in a poignant scene from Middle-America. (Sure that sounds vaguely sexist, but look at her.) Looks however can be deceiving. Her confirmed remarks in the video presentation that has received hundreds of thousands of views so far, proves that this is no woman who values all American citizens equally. When it comes to agendas there is no mistaking hers. Republican darling Sally Kern seeks to stop in its tracks any effort for fair representation of gays in government, and she takes a scathing view of them; and also Islam in the bargain. This Oklahoma legislator, wife of Dr. Steve Kern, pastor of Olivet Baptist Church, shows that bigotry exists in the American heartland against not just one class but two classes of Americans, gays and Muslims. This did not become a national issue because a gay rights group made a video presentation using her recorded comments. It became a national issue because of her calling out various other states, Arkansas, Pennsylvania, Maryland and Florida. She did so by claiming that various city councils in those states have been "infiltrated" by gays. And this is an election year, a time when Americans will decide if they want real change or do they want a continuation of American domestic and foreign policy based upon some twisted version of evangelical values that have impeded and retarded America's progress and standing for more than seven years? No word yet on whether John McCain supports these divisive and extreme remarks by Sally Kern, so we have prepared a full transcript of the remarks Kern made for his, and his campaign's, perusal: Full transcript of a speech by Sally Kern on the "gay agenda" with a backhanded slap at Islam The homosexual agenda [Loud snap] is destroying this nation. OK? It's just a fact. [Volume increases] Not everybody's lifestyle is equal, just like not all religions are equal. You know, the very fact that I'm talking to you like this here today, puts me in jeopardy. OK? Uh and I'm not anti, I'm not gay-bashing, but according to God's word that is not the right kind of lifestyle, it has deadly consequences for those people involved in it, they have more suicides, uh and they're more discouraged, there's more illness, their uh lifespans are shorter, you know? It's, it's, it's not a lifestyle that is good for this nation. 'Matter of fact, studies show, that no society that has totally embraced homosexuality has lasted more than, you know, a few decades. So it's the death knell of this country. I honestly think it's the biggest threat even, that our nation has, even more so than terrorism or Islam, which I think is a big threat. OK? Because what's happening now, they're going after er uh in schools - two year-olds! You know why they're trying to get early childhood education? They want to get our young children into the government schools so they can indoctrinate them! I taught school for close to twenty years and we're not teaching facts and knowledge anymore folks, we're teaching indoctrination. OK? And they're going after our young children, as young as two years of age, to try to teach them that the homosexual lifestyle is the acceptable lifestyle. You know, gays are infiltrating city councils. Do you know? Eureka Springs [Arkansas], anybody been there, for the [Great] Passion Play? [A "Creation Truth" production] OK, have you heard that the city council of Eureka Springs is now controlled by gays? OK? There are some others. Uh, Pittsburgh, Pa.; Tacoma, Md.; Kensington, Md.; in Vermont, Oregon, West Palm Beach, Fla. and a lot of other places in Florida. What's happening? And they are winning elections. One of the things I deal with in our legislature, I tried to introduce a bill last year, that would notify parents, uh schools had to let parents know what clubs their students were involved in. And the reason I did that bill, primarily, was this, we had the Gay-Straight Alliance coming into our schools. Kids are getting involved in these groups, their lives are being ruined, their parents don't know about it. So I introduced a bill that said you have to notify all clubs, and things. And one of my colleagues said, "Well, you know we don't have a gay problem in my community, so that's why I voted against that bill." Well you know what? To me that is so dumb. If you've got cancer or something in your little toe, do you say, Well you know I’m just gonna forget about it, 'cause the rest of you's fine? It spreads! OK? And this, this stuff is deadly, and it's spreading and it will destroy uh our young people, it will destroy this nation. source: http://bbsnews.net/article.php/200803112057130 Yes, everything spreads!
